Ingredients
Scale
Brownie Mix
- 1 box brownie mix (plus required ingredients specified on the package such as oil, eggs, and water)
French Silk Layer
- 3/4 cup butter, softened
- 1/2 cup sugar
- 4 tablespoons cocoa powder
- 3 large eggs
Topping and Garnish
- 1 container (8 oz) whipped topping (such as Cool Whip), thawed
- Chocolate shavings or curls (optional, for garnish)
Instructions
- Prepare and bake brownies: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) or follow the temperature specified on your boxed brownie mix package. Prepare the brownie batter according to package directions, then pour it into a greased 9×13-inch baking dish. Bake as directed, then remove from oven and allow the brownies to cool completely before proceeding.
- Make the French silk layer: In a mixing bowl, beat the softened butter and sugar together until the mixture becomes light and fluffy. This provides the base for the creamy topping.
- Add cocoa powder: Mix the cocoa powder into the butter and sugar mixture thoroughly until well combined and smooth, lending a rich chocolate flavor and silky texture.
- Incorporate eggs: Beat in the eggs one at a time, mixing on high speed for about three minutes with each addition. This whipping process creates a creamy, airy consistency reminiscent of classic French silk pie filling.
- Assemble the layers: Spread the prepared French silk mixture evenly over the completely cooled brownies, ensuring a smooth and uniform layer.
- Add whipped topping: Generously top the French silk layer with the thawed whipped topping, smoothing it out evenly for a creamy finish.
- Garnish: Sprinkle chocolate shavings or curls over the whipped topping for an attractive and delicious finishing touch.
- Chill before serving: Place the assembled brownies in the refrigerator and chill for at least 2 to 3 hours, or until the French silk topping is fully set. Slice into squares and serve chilled for optimal flavor and texture.
Notes
- Ensure brownies are completely cooled before adding the French silk layer to prevent melting and uneven texture.
- Beating eggs thoroughly into the butter and sugar mixture is key to achieving the signature silky texture of French silk.
- Use high-quality cocoa powder for the best chocolate flavor in the French silk topping.
- Keep the brownies refrigerated until serving to help the topping set properly and maintain its creamy consistency.
- Chocolate shavings can be made using a vegetable peeler on a chocolate bar or purchased pre-made for convenience.
